Output e152ddceec25f0f270f48dfdee83c39e7b2f71c1e6e17a19303bc2ab85f896d2:0

value
5898640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0970f9e2fd8ce6d25d533b14810e6ec931f40874 OP_EQUAL
address
32YwLzJ53Kf6AWtVTfSftn9YuvAXZ1WQae
transaction
e152ddceec25f0f270f48dfdee83c39e7b2f71c1e6e17a19303bc2ab85f896d2
spent
true